3. Disconnect brewer from the power source.

If voltage was present as described, proceed to #4.
If voltage was not present as described, refer to the

Wiring Diagrams

and check brewer wiring harness.

4. Remove the pink wire from terminal 5 of the

electronic control assembly (1).

5. With a voltmeter, check the voltage across termi-

nals 1 & 4 of the electronic control assembly (1).
Connect brewer to the power source. The indica-
tion must be:
a.) 208 volts ac for three wire 120/208 volt models
and 240 volts ac for three wire 120/240 volt
models after a delay of approximately 1 second.
b.) 200 to 240 volts ac for two wire 200 or 240 volt
models after a delay of approximately 1 second.

6. Disconnect the brewer from the power source.

If voltage was present as described, the liquid level
control system is operating properly, proceed to #7.
If voltage was not present as described, replace the
electronic control assembly (1) and temperature sen-
sor (8) in the tank lid.

NOTE - each electronic control assembly is calibrated
to a temperature sensor. Both components MUST be
replaced as a set.

7. Reconnect the pink wire to terminal 5 of the

electronic control assembly (1).

8. Remove the liquid level probe (7) from the tank lid,

and inspect it for mineral deposits. Replace it if
necessary. Keep the exposed ends of the probe
away from any metal surface of the brewer.

9. With a voltmeter, check the voltage across termi-

nals 1 & 4 of the electronic control assembly (1).
Connect the brewer to the power source. The
indication must be:
a.) 208 volts ac for three wire 120/208 volt models
and 240 volts ac for three wire 120/240 volt
models after a delay of approximately 1 second.
b.) 200 to 240 volts ac for two wire 208 or 240 volt
models after a delay of approximately 1 second.

10. Touch the screw head end of the probe to the

brewer housing. The indication must be 0.

11. Move the probe away from the brewer housing.

The indication must again be:
a.) 208 volts ac for three wire 120/208 volt models
and 240 volts ac for three wire120/240 volt
models after a delay of approximately 1 second.
b.) 200 to 240 volts ac for two wire 200 or 240 volt
models after a delay of approximately 1 second.

12. Disconnect the brewer from the power source.

If voltage was present as described, reinstall the
probe, the sensing function of the system is operating
properly.
If voltage was not present as described, check the pink
probe wire and the green ground wire for continuity
and/or replace the probe.
